Is it Illegal to Have a Secret Room?
In recent years, secret rooms have gained popularity, with many people opting to create hidden spaces in their homes for various reasons. Whether it’s to escape the hustle and bustle of daily life, to create a secure storage area, or to simply indulge in a sense of exclusivity, secret rooms can be a fascinating and unique feature to have. But, the question remains: is it illegal to have a secret room?
Direct Answer
In most cases, having a secret room is not illegal. As long as you are the rightful owner of the property, you have the freedom to do as you please with it. However, there are certain restrictions and considerations to keep in mind when creating a secret room.
Legal Considerations
While having a secret room may not be illegal per se, there are several legal considerations to take into account:
- Local Building Codes: Check your local building codes to ensure that your secret room meets all necessary requirements. For example, you may need to obtain a permit before constructing a new room.
- Zoning Regulations: Verify that your secret room complies with your area’s zoning regulations. This may include restrictions on the size and location of the room.
- Neighborhood Agreements: If you live in a neighborhood with covenants, conditions, and restrictions (CC&Rs), be sure to check your documents to ensure that your secret room does not violate any of these agreements.

Types of Secret Rooms
There are many types of secret rooms, each with its own unique characteristics and purposes:
- Hidden Rooms: These rooms are designed to be hidden from view, often by blending in with the surrounding decor or being concealed behind a bookshelf or sliding panel.
- Secret Staircases: These staircases are designed to lead to hidden rooms or areas, often used for escape or surveillance purposes.
- Murphy Rooms: These rooms are designed to be collapsible, often used as a storage space or temporary office.
